Trump Blames 🇷🇺Russia, Not 🇨🇳China, for 🇰🇵N-Korea Tensions


President Donald Trump has praised China’s efforts in helping the U.S. contain the nuclear threat from North Korea, but criticized Russia's stance on the growing tensions with Pyongyang.

The president said that Moscow’s influence in dealing with North Korea has not been beneficial to the U.S. efforts to contain the country’s nuclear threat.

“China is helping us and maybe Russia’s going through the other way and hurting what we’re getting,” Trump said. “When I say ‘maybe,’ I know exactly what I’m talking about,” he added, cryptically.

The praise for Chinese efforts signal a shift in tone for the president, who has at times scoffed at China for not doing enough on North Korea, or trying to help but with "little success"—just on time for his meeting with President Xi Jinping as part of a trip to Asia next month.

China is North Korea’s closest ally in the region but Russia has also stepped up its level of engagement in the peninsula, seeking to position itself as a mediator and win infrastructure projects along the way.
